All of the services that are allowed to start in Safe Mode are stored in the registry folder HKEY_LOCAL_MACHINE\SYSTEM\CurrentControlSet\Control\SafeBoot\Minimal\Īll you have to do is to add a REG_SZ key with the service name (not the display name) and the value data "Service" (without quotes). The good thing is that it is not really difficult to outsmart Windows Safe Mode. If you try to uninstall software in Safe Mode, Windows will just inform you that: "The Windows Installer Service could not be started." Trying to start the service manually will only get you: "Error 1084: This service cannot be started in Safe Mode."
